Mati Lampu Sing-Along




Tonight was our first Friday back home and we were looking forward to it when right at 6 o'clock, all the lights died. Mati Lampu literally means 'dead light'. This could mean black-out anywhere from 30 minutes to 2 hours or even up to 5 hours. And this place gets pretty hot, pretty fast, especially without any fans. We opted to spend the evening outside, under our grape vine, in our new lawn furniture (yeah plastic chairs!). Within a few minutes we had Anna giggling and doing the motions along with 'The Itsy Bitsty Spider' and 'My God is so Big!' At that point the Sing-Along started. Joseph would start one and then Lindsey would choose one, and we went back and forth singing worship songs for a good hour or so. What started out as downer Friday night ended up as an unplanned, fun family time: just the 3 of us, sitting under a grape vine, watching the stars, singing together, and listening to Anna's precious little laugh and sweet little voice as she tried to sing along. I guess even Mati Lampus can be a good thing!
